Senior Team
The County League is scaled down to five games per team. Division 2 is split into A and B and we play in B.  We have two home games and three away games in this competition. In this Division: Three teams are promoted –  the top team in each Section plus a play-off between second placed team in each Section

Coiste Trá Lí Junior League
Coiste Trá Lí is running a District Junior league in late June. Ballymac Junior Team is in Group B with Austin Stacks C, Churchill B & St Pats B. The Competition will start on Tuesday 22nd June., 2nd round is on the June 29th and the 3rd round is on the July 6th. Fixtures and Kick Off Times will follow in the next few days.

Ladies News:

Ladies club membership

It’s great to see such a high number in our ladies squad. This year we have 90 players in our teams from U12 up to Senior and an additional 40 or so playing with the academy. The future of Ladies football in Ballymacelligott is looking good.

Goalkeeper workshop

On Wednesday last our U16 and Senior Goalies were put through their paces by Mike Crossan, former Donegal goalkeeper. The girls thoroughly enjoyed the session.
